Output ec99f0e54b5b97c1351d2ea95aa1dd242338d913c08e909dce23236c846558e4:1

value
66909305
script pubkey
OP_0 OP_PUSHBYTES_20 369aa87a402bb7cd2021efdaf80971f727865633
address
bc1qx6d2s7jq9wmu6gppald0szt37uncv43njluyq8
transaction
ec99f0e54b5b97c1351d2ea95aa1dd242338d913c08e909dce23236c846558e4
spent
true